What is Intellectual Property?
This seminar will cover the basics for each of the intellectual property rights: patents, copyrights, trademarks and trade secrets, each of which will be covered in more depth in workshops scheduled for upcoming months. This is an entertaining survey of these rights, including famous/recent cases in the Supreme Court.
